跳转到内容

Koishi.js

维基百科,自由的百科全书
Koishi.js
原作者Shigma
開發者Koishi 开发团队[1]
首次发布2020年1月,​4年前​(2020-01[2]
当前版本
  • 4.17.12(2024年8月15日;穩定版本)[3]
編輯維基數據鏈接
源代码库 編輯維基數據鏈接
编程语言TypeScript
操作系统跨平台
类型聊天機器人框架
许可协议 編輯維基數據鏈接
网站koishi.chat 编辑维基数据

Koishi.js(通称 Koishi)是一个跨平台的聊天機器人框架,其使用 TypeScript 开发,可在 Node.js 上运行。[4][5]

Koishi 标识来源于东方 Project 中的角色古明地戀 (Komeiji Koishi)。[6]

特性

开箱即用

Koishi 提供了控制台(WebUI),降低了操作门槛,用户可以通过控制台查看运行状态,以及修改配置。

Koishi 提供在线插件市场,让没有编程基础的用户也能搭建机器人。

Koishi 支持 QQTelegramDiscord飞书等主流聊天平台。[6]

专为开发者打造

Koishi 为开发者准备了类型支持[註 1]单元测试、模块热重载等功能,使开发者得以在各种情况下构建规模化的解决方案。[6]

附注

  1. ^ 基于 TypeScript

参考文献

  1. ^ koishi/CONTRIBUTING.md, Koishi.js, [2023-03-31], (原始内容存档于2023-04-01) 
  2. ^ 发展史 | Koishi. koishi.chat. [2023-04-01]. (原始内容存档于2023-03-31). 
  3. ^ Release 4.17.12. 2024年8月15日 [2024年8月22日]. 
  4. ^ Koishi | Koishi. koishi.chat. [2023-03-31]. (原始内容存档于2023-03-31). 
  5. ^ 开发指南 | Koishi. koishi.chat. [2023-03-31]. (原始内容存档于2023-03-31). 
  6. ^ 6.0 6.1 6.2 Koishi, Koishi.js, [2023-03-31], (原始内容存档于2023-06-03) 

外部链接